The number 14 in the marking 185/70R 14, present on a tire, represents the diameter of the rim, expressed in inches, meaning the equivalent of 365 mm.
The markings on the sidewalls such as 185/70R 14 84V mean:
- 185 represents the width of the tire in millimetres.
- 70 represents the ratio between the sidewall height and the width of the tire.
- R represents the radial structure.
- 14 represents the inner diameter of the tire.
- 84 represents the maximum admissible load on a tire at maximum speed, this number being the equivalent of a 500 kg load.
- V represents the speed index.
